The steel beam connects to the supporting column or girder web through a Grade 50 plate matching the beam web thickness with a one-half inch minimum. The shear tab is welded to the supporting member using fillet welds sized per drawings with three-sided welding. The connection is secured with one-inch diameter A325SC Class A slip-critical bolts configured in rows per the typical connection schedule. A maximum clearance of one-half inch is maintained typically at the beam end. The framing members are sized per plan.
